How Common Is The Last Name McOllough?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 3,602,217th most commonly used family name at a global level, borne by around 1 in 242,918,197 people. The last name is mostly found in The Americas, where 100 percent of McOllough live; 100 percent live in North America and 100 percent live in Anglo-North America.
It is most frequently occurring in The United States, where it is held by 30 people, or 1 in 12,081,964. In The United States McOllough is mostly concentrated in: Iowa, where 33 percent live, Arizona, where 13 percent live and Alabama, where 7 percent live.
McOllough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The frequency of McOllough has changed over time. In The United States the number of people who held the McOllough surname fell 12 percent between 1880 and 2014.
